'Atonement', 'Sweeney Todd' scoop Globes
Published Monday, Jan 14 2008, 10:33 GMT | By Alex Fletcher

'Atonement' / Universal
Johnny Depp bagged the best actor gong for his role in Tim Burton's musical Sweeney Todd, which also won the best musical or comedy film accolade.
The British romantic drama Atonement landed the best drama film award and also took away the title for best original score.
Daniel Day Lewis scooped the best drama actor award for his part in There Will Be Blood, while Julie Christie won the best drama actress title for her performance in Away From Her.
In the television categories Ricky Gervais' Extras won the best musical or comedy series accolade, while Mad Men was given the best drama series gong.
